Historian Ellen Fitzpatrick has selected 250 letters from the over 1.5 million letter of condolence to Jackie Kennedy on the assassination of President John F. Kennedy, November, 1963, an unforgettable time in U.S.history. These letters reveal and preserve the truly heart-wrenching grief and soul searching of the nation after this most tragic loss. 351 pages including The Letter Writers, Letter Citations, Notes, Photograph Permissions. 6.25 x 9.5 inches. "A terrific, original, and important work.Fitzpatrick provides a stunningly fresh look at the impact of JFK's assassination on the American people."--Doris Kearns GoodwinFor Letters to Jackie, noted historian and News Hour with Jim Lehrer commentator Ellen Fitzpatrick combed through literally thousands of condolence messages sent by ordinary Americans to Jacqueline Kennedy following the assassination of her husband, President John F. Kennedy, in 1963. The first book ever to examine this extraordinary collection, Letters to Jackie presents 250 intimate, heartfelt, eye-opening responses to what was arguably the most devastating event in twentieth century America, providing a fascinating perspective on a singular time in the history of our nation.
